The study evaluates the dose induced by Auger electrons emitted from Sb-119 in a tumor and surrounding healthy tissues, highlighting the significance of accurate target therapy planning based on the absorbed dose calculations.
The purpose of this study is dose evaluation induced by Auger electrons emitted from Sb-119 in a tumor and surrounding healthy tissues. Dose evaluation was done by using the MCNP6 code in the tumor and healthy tissue (in thyroid follicles) and the calculated absorbed dose was significant. Most of the Auger electron energy emitted from Sb-119 deposits in the decay position, so the effectiveness of Auger electrons should not be ignored also an accurate target therapy can be planned by them.
